A zirconium crown is a type of dental crown made from zirconia, which is a ceramic material that is strong, durable, and biocompatible with the human body. Zirconium crowns are often used to restore damaged or decayed teeth, as well as to improve the appearance of discolored or misshapen teeth.
Zirconium crowns are preferred by many dentists and patients because they offer several benefits over other types of dental crowns, including:
Durability: Zirconium is a very strong and durable material, making it a good choice for crowns that need to withstand the forces of biting and chewing.
Aesthetics: Zirconium crowns can be matched to the color of your natural teeth, making them virtually indistinguishable from the surrounding teeth.
Biocompatibility: Zirconium is a biocompatible material, meaning that it is unlikely to cause an allergic reaction or other adverse reaction in the body.
Precision: Zirconium crowns can be milled with very high precision, ensuring a perfect fit and minimal adjustments during the fitting process.
Overall, zirconium crowns are a popular choice for dental restoration due to their strength, durability, and aesthetic appeal. However, like any dental procedure, it’s important to consult with your dentist to determine whether a zirconium crown is the best option for your individual needs.
